地方网站 源码自动点击器下载

张小明 2026/1/12 20:35:22
地方网站 源码,自动点击器下载,本溪市住房和城乡建设局网站,建设网站前需要的市场分析MIPI DSI DPHY FPGA工程源码 mipi-dsi tx/mipi-dphy协议解析 MIPI DSI协议文档 纯verilog 彩条实现驱动mipi屏幕 1024*600像素。 的是fpga工程#xff0c;非专业人士勿。 artix7-100t mipi-dsi未使用xilinx mipi的IP。 以及几个项目开发时搜集的MIPI DSI参考源码。最近在折腾…MIPI DSI DPHY FPGA工程源码 mipi-dsi tx/mipi-dphy协议解析 MIPI DSI协议文档 纯verilog 彩条实现驱动mipi屏幕 1024*600像素。 的是fpga工程非专业人士勿。 artix7-100t mipi-dsi未使用xilinx mipi的IP。 以及几个项目开发时搜集的MIPI DSI参考源码。最近在折腾FPGA驱动MIPI屏幕这事发现网上现成的工程要么用IP核收费要么藏着掖着关键代码。正好手头有块Artix7-100T开发板自己撸了个纯Verilog实现的MIPI DSI驱动实测点亮了1024x600的屏幕这里把踩过的坑和实现思路捋一捋。先说硬件层MIPI DPHY这玩意真不是吃素的。别看协议文档里时序图画得挺规范实际用FPGA搞裸协议栈光是HS传输模式的切换就够喝一壶。我的做法是把DPHY拆成三个模块时钟Lane控制器、数据Lane状态机和escape模式转换器。这里贴个数据Lane状态机的核心代码always(posedge dphy_clk) begin case(state) STOP: begin lp_en 1b1; if(tx_request) state HS_REQUEST; end HS_REQUEST: begin lp_en 1b0; state HS_PREPARE; end HS_PREPARE: begin hs_en 1b1; state HS_ZERO; cnt 16d0; end HS_ZERO: begin hs_data 16h0000; if(cnt 16d8) state HS_SYNC; else cnt cnt 1; end //...其他状态省略 endcase end这状态机主要处理LP到HS模式的转换重点注意HSZERO状态需要持续至少8个时钟周期的TLPX时间。实测中发现如果这个时间不达标屏幕直接黑脸给你看。时钟Lane那边更刺激需要根据屏幕规格书里的参数动态调整分频系数像我这个工程里用到了parameter CLK_DIV (85000000/(2*60000000)) - 1; //85MHz输入转60MHzDSI控制器的实现就更有意思了。协议里的长包结构得自己组装特别是CRC计算部分我参考了某开源项目的查表法实现。举个发送图像行数据的例子// 组装包头 header[5:0] 6h2A; // 数据类型 header[15:8] 8h04; // 数据长度低8位 header[23:16] 8h00; // 数据长度高8位 header[31:24] crc8(header[23:0]); // CRC计算 // 行数据载荷 payload[1023:0] {rgb565_data}; crc16 crc16(payload);这里有个坑点DSI的像素数据需要按照屏幕指定的格式排列。比如我驱动的这款屏要求RGB565格式就得把FPGA生成的像素数据拆成16bit一组还得注意大小端问题。测试时用彩条图案最靠谱// 彩条生成逻辑 always(posedge pixel_clk) begin if(hcount 341) rgb 16hF800; // 红 else if(hcount 682) rgb 16h07E0; // 绿 else rgb 16h001F; // 蓝 // 省略同步计数逻辑... end调试阶段建议先用ILA抓取DPHY信号。重点看HS模式下的差分信号眼图必要时调整IO延迟参数。像Artix7的IDELAYE2模块就派上用场了IDELAYE2 #( .IDELAY_TYPE(FIXED), .DELAY_SRC(IDATAIN), .IDELAY_VALUE(12) ) dphy_delay [3:0] ();工程最终占用了约23%的LUT和15%的FF资源时序收敛在450MHz左右。不过提醒下想复现的兄弟MIPI对信号完整性要求极高硬件设计时记得做阻抗匹配PCB走线长度差控制在±50mil以内。完整工程里还包含了不同分辨率屏幕的适配方案以及LP模式下的寄存器配置脚本。需要参考的可以去Github搜这几个关键词mipi-dsi-fpga-verilog、dphy-hs-mode-switch、dsi-crc-generator。最后放张点亮效果图镇楼假装有图下期讲讲怎么在这个架构上跑视频流。
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

做民俗酒店到哪些网站推荐上海待遇好的十大国企排名

目录已开发项目效果实现截图开发技术介绍系统开发工具:核心代码参考示例1.建立用户稀疏矩阵,用于用户相似度计算【相似度矩阵】2.计算目标用户与其他用户的相似度系统测试总结源码文档获取/同行可拿货,招校园代理 :文章底部获取博主联系方式&…

张小明 2026/1/7 16:57:46 网站建设

潍坊网站制作小程序自己可以创建网站吗

Linux 权限管理:保护与共享工作资源的全面指南 1. 权限显示与解读 在 Linux 系统中,权限信息以一系列由破折号和字母组成的字符串形式,显示在每行的开头。下面是对其详细解读: - 文件类型标识 :字符串的第一个字符用于指示文件的类型。普通文件(如 reme.txt )显示…

张小明 2026/1/1 22:34:08 网站建设

网站建设与管理这门课程的介绍张家港建网站费用

OCLP-Mod技术解析:如何让不支持的Mac设备运行最新macOS 【免费下载链接】OCLP-Mod A mod version for OCLP,with more interesting features. 项目地址: https://gitcode.com/gh_mirrors/oc/OCLP-Mod 对于许多拥有老旧Mac设备的用户来说,最大的痛…

张小明 2026/1/10 3:08:52 网站建设

淄博网站优化服务广东广州

Python自动化CATIA:从零构建高效CAD设计工作流 【免费下载链接】pycatia 项目地址: https://gitcode.com/gh_mirrors/py/pycatia 在数字化设计领域,pycatia项目为工程师提供了强大的Python自动化解决方案,彻底改变了传统CATIA V5的手…

张小明 2026/1/3 8:06:25 网站建设

怎样建网站得花多少钱如何做网站图片切换

3需求分析 在这一章中将对本论文要实现的教育平台进行详尽的可行性分析、需求分析等,本章内容主要涵盖了对系统预期应用环境的分析,对系统功能和安全性需求的分析,最后还有对系统的功能需求的分析[8]。这一章的内容将为之后的系统设计和实现提…

张小明 2026/1/9 10:41:14 网站建设

企业网站内容管理刹车片图纸网站建设

Qwen3-235B-A22B:双模式革命重塑企业AI应用范式 【免费下载链接】Qwen3-235B-A22B-MLX-6bit 项目地址: https://ai.gitcode.com/hf_mirrors/Qwen/Qwen3-235B-A22B-MLX-6bit 导语:阿里开源大模型如何用220亿参数实现性能与成本的双向突破 2025年…

张小明 2026/1/1 22:34:11 网站建设